Hope College is a private institution located in Holland, MI. It is a Baccalaureate's College by Carnegie Classification. You can view and compare Baccalaureate's College Faculty Salary page.
Average Faculty and Staff Salary
Hope College has 693 employees including both faculty and non-instructional staffs. The average faculty is $76,740 and the average non-teaching staff salary is $64,487. The average faculty salary increased 1.17% ($888) from last year at Hope College. The non-instructional staff salary has risen 6.44% ($3,899) from last year.

Holland City School District General Information
Hope College located in Holland City School District area. A total of 13,437 households are located in Holland City School District area. It has 8 including Pre-K and K-12 schools with 3,844 students. The median value of home price is $156,800 and the average rent cost is $869.
